When was the spiral galaxy discovered?

It wasn't until telescopes that people realized that the band of light reaching across the sky, called the Milky Way since ancient times, was actually made of an immense number of stars. Astronomers still did not really understand what they were seeing until the 20th century, however.Until the 1920s, astronomers thought that what we now know to be our Milky Way Galaxy to be the entire universe, and that our whole universe was a few thousand light years across. Other "spiral nebulae" had been observed, but they were thought to be new star systems forming nearby. After Hubble (the astronomer, not the telescope named for him) observed Cepheid variable stars in the Great Nebula in Andromeda, he realized that the Andromeda "Nebula" was immensley distant, and ennormous in size, and, by extension, the other "spiral nebulae" were also huge and incomprehensibly distant. He called them "island universes", and realized that we were also in one, and that the 'Milky Way' band of stars across the sky was our galaxy's disk, seen from inside. So, even though people have been calling the band of light across the sky the Milky Way for thousands of years, it wasn't until the 1920's that we understood what it was--our galaxy!We can see only a small part of our galaxy in visible light. Since the 1960s, radio astronomers have mapped out the structure of the entire galaxy, and shown it to be a large spiral galaxy of about 100 billion stars; we are in one of the spiral arms about 8 kiloparsecs (25,000 light years) from the center of our galaxy, more or less halfway from the center to the edge.I think Gallileo came across the milky way in the 1600's. Dr. Frank Drake of the SETI Institute designed a formula that can be used to predict the potential for the existence of life elsewhere (anywhere other than Earth) in the universe. Essentially, the Drake Equation is a probability predictor, and presents the high probability that life does exist somewhere. The equation is: N = R* • fp • ne • fl • fi • fc • L What that means is: N = Is the number of civilizations in The Milky Way Galaxy whose electromagnetic emissions are detectable. R* =Is the rate of formation of stars suitable for the development of intelligent life. fp = Is the fraction of those stars with planetary systems. ne = Is the number of planets, per solar system, with an environment suitable for life. fl = Is the fraction of suitable planets on which life actually appears. fi = Is the fraction of life bearing planets on which intelligent life emerges. fc = Is the fraction of civilizations that develop a technology that releases detectable signs of their existence into space. L = Is the length of time such civilizations release detectable signals into space. The idea that there could be other life in the universe was a groundbreaking concept in 1961 when Drake first presented his idea. At that time, we did not know of any other planetary bodies around other stars. As of the writing of this answer (October 2013) 990 planetary bodies have been discovered in 754 planetary systems. The Kepler mission has detected thousands of potential candidate stars with potential planets orbiting them, and 252 potentially habitable planets. It has been estimated that there may be 17 billion Earth-sized planets in the Milkyway Galaxy (our galaxy) alone. What will the James Webb telescope detect?

Webb will find the first galaxies that formed in the early Universe, connecting the Big Bang to our own Milky Way Galaxy. Webb will peer through dusty clouds to see stars forming planetary systems, connecting the Milky Way to our own Solar System. Webb's instruments will be designed to work primarily in the infrared range of the electromagnetic spectrum, with some capability in the visible range.

Is the Andromeda Nebula Galaxy closest to The Milky Way Galaxy Or is there another that is even closer?

The closest galaxies to the Milky Way are(in order of increasing distance):Sagittarius Dwarf GalaxyCanis Major Dwarf GalaxyThe Large Magellanic CloudThe Small Magellanic CloudThe Andromeda GalaxyThe Triangulum GalaxyNote: The first four galaxies are dwarfs, which are significantly smaller than the Milky Way.
